Golden Sun I is a role-playing game released in 2001 for the Game Boy Advance. The game centers around a group of young Adepts who harness elemental magic called Psynergy to prevent the rekindling of ancient forces threatening their world. Players navigate through a fantasy landscape, solving puzzles, battling enemies, and progressing the storyline by exploring various towns and dungeons.

The main objective involves stopping the release of alchemy, which has the potential to either save or destroy the world. The game's pace is a balanced blend of exploration, strategic turn-based combat, and puzzle-solving, providing a steady progression without rushing the player. A unique mechanic in Golden Sun I is the use of Psynergy both in battle and in the environment, allowing players to manipulate objects or terrain to advance.

One unusual idea is the Djinn system, where players collect elemental spirits that can be assigned to characters, altering their abilities and combat roles dynamically. This adds a layer of customization and strategy uncommon in RPGs of its time. The game's distinctive art style and music contribute to a rich, immersive experience on a handheld device.
